Homage
Summary
Acts of reverence, respect, or worship shown to those in authority, particularly to God and to kings.
☩Biblical Examples
Prostration (bowing to the ground) was common homage to kings and superiors (Genesis 43:26; 2 Samuel 9:6). The Hebrew 'hishtachavah' can mean either social obeisance or religious worship depending on context. The wise men 'fell down and worshiped' the infant Jesus (Matthew 2:11). Angels and elders give homage to God around His throne (Revelation 4:10; 5:14). The first commandment reserves ultimate homage for God alone.
